 |  Where are We? World Sport Ministries International HQ is based in Bath, 
            England and since January 1999, has developed teams of people to use 
            sports events such as schools coaching programmes, holiday clinics, 
            sports dinners and national / international sports events in England, 
            South Africa, and Kenya. We have began activities in Kenya, Sierra Leone, Rwanda and Pakistan, 
              with projects in India and Nigeria.  To date, God has been busy sending and using sports coaches that 
              we have visiting schools in the west of England; daily seeking opportunities 
              to share the great news of Jesus Christ. Added to this we have set 
              up and established sports 'huddles' linked with churches, where 
              reached children are taught God's Word in a sporty environment. Each local area team, made up by church reps, established by God, 
              will pray, agree on and stage a combination of regular and special 
              outreaching events to impact their area with the gospel.

                them in the sporting arena.  Our Plan The Lord has given World Sport Ministries a hands 
              on, activating approach through launching and developing a local 
              area interdenominational sports team in an area of each country 
              where He opens doors, which can then be duplicated in other areas 
              of that country using the series of World Sport Ministries presentation 
              and training videos. Each team will be led by a suitably qualified 
              co-ordinator, and will be developed with the help of current World 
              Sport Ministries leadership. Each team then uses sport as a tool 
              to impact their area using the many different types of outreach 
              and discipleship available.   What we BelieveWe believe that there is only one God. Forever existent in three

 How World Sport Ministries Began
 From an early age I realised that sport was my thing. I didn't 
              understand that it was from God until I was much older, but sport 
              was why I lived as a child through to my early twenties. You could 
              say that sport was my God! It was clear at school that the only future career I desired was 
              in sport. I was either going to play professionally or coach others 
              to. Well, I tried to make it as a pro cricketer and nearly cracked 
              it, but it wasn't to be having played semi professionally, so coaching 
              it was. I started coaching at the age of 16 and pursued it as a career 
              when I left college at 18. I worked secularly as a schools coach 
              and cricket development officer in communities as well as directing 
              the coaching at my local club. My big break however, was when I 
              was asked to coach on a development programme in the Free State 
              of South Africa. Off I went, in excitement in September 2004; what 
              I didn't realise was how my life was about to change. Three days into my stay I met a lady who is now my wife. That whole 
              story is a testimony in itself; but she felt sorry for me as a stranger 
              in a strange place, and compassionately reached out to me in friendship, 
              demonstrating the love of God. As I got to know her, it was clear 
              that she had something I didn't, and having told me of her late 
              brother's death where he was hit by a drunk driver on the side of 
              the road; she said that he was ready to go as he knew Jesus, and 
              that he's in heaven and not hell. I knew of God but didn't know 
              Him, so I prayed to receive Christ by faith. I thank God for getting 
              me on the plane to S.A, as I gained a wife and eternal life! Eighteen months later, whilst driving back from a schools coaching 
              session in England, I was worshipping God when the Holy Spirit spoke 
              to me and said, "I want you to work for me like you work for 
              your cricket union." I didn't know what that meant as I had 
              never heard of sports ministry and I had only been saved just over 
              a year. My wife and I prayed and fasted, but further information 
              was temporarily withheld; I therefore assumed that God wanted me 
              to tell the people I coached about Jesus. I started to do this without 
              any real plan, but I now know that God wanted to see if I would 
              be faithful with the little, prior to more responsibility. Three years later, in July 1998 I was at home in South Africa reading 
              some spirit building literature when the Holy Spirit came upon me 
              out of the blue. For the next 45 minutes the Lord reminded me about 
              the sports ministry calling and proceeded to give me an amazing 
              outline of what He now wanted me to do; He even gave me the name 
              World Sport Ministries. There afterwards, God supernaturally put 
              me together with key people who could advise, train and mentor me. 
              I now knew the real reason why I was alive. God's vision for WSM is to begin community sports ministry teams 
              with people from different churches using their talents and evangelical 
              desire to plan events and strategies that will reach people that 
              churches struggle to reach through the powerful and relevant tool 
              of sport. I have learned that the people of the world love sport 
              and that the creator of sport and the world loves people. So much 
              so that He wants them to know Him so that He may rescue them from 
              a place called hell. It's still early days, but we have planted teams and trained leaders 
              in 5 different countries with many more to follow. thousands of 
              people have come to know Christ, and sporty minded Christians are 
              now realising that they can and should use their talents to serve 
              God. I sincerely believe that sport enables us to take church to 
              the people as it enables the body of Christ to relationally reach 
              the largest number of people in the shortest space of time. In partnership with others, and led only by the Spirit of God,
